Material Composition and Metallurgical Balance
The foundation of a Tibetan singing bowl’s performance begins with its metal composition. Beyond visual finish, the precise balance and quality of metals directly influence resonance, durability, and tonal consistency over time.
- Traditional alloy formulation: Carefully selected metal combinations create a stable foundation for resonance and sound layering. The alloy balance directly affects weight distribution and vibration flow across the bowl. This precision allows sustained tones that remain consistent during prolonged use.
- Metal purity and stability: High-purity metals ensure structural strength and long-term acoustic reliability. They prevent deformation and tonal imbalance caused by frequent playing. Lower-quality blends often lose clarity, reducing functional lifespan over time.
- Thermal and acoustic response: Quality metals respond evenly to changes in temperature and playing pressure. This stability protects sound clarity in different environments and conditions. Balanced compositions support dependable performance for professional applications.
Together, these material factors determine whether a singing bowl delivers consistent sound performance over time or remains limited to visual appeal alone.
Craftsmanship Techniques and Production Method
How a singing bowl is made is just as important as what it is made from. Traditional production methods and artisan involvement play a decisive role in shaping sound depth, structural stability, and overall functional value.
- Hand-hammered shaping process: Gradual hammering strengthens molecular alignment within the metal structure. This process enhances harmonic richness and sound depth over time. Machine-pressed bowls often sacrifice acoustic complexity for visual uniformity.
- Artisan skill and experience: Expert craftsmanship ensures precise symmetry and controlled rim thickness. These elements directly influence tonal balance and vibration consistency. Such refined skills are cultivated through years of hands-on practice.
- Time investment per piece: Extended shaping periods allow internal metal stress to settle naturally. This improves resonance stability and tonal sustain during use. Accelerated production often weakens sound quality and durability.
Ultimately, craftsmanship defines not just how a bowl looks, but how reliably it performs throughout years of regular use.
Acoustic Performance and Frequency Range
Sound quality is the most defining characteristic of a singing bowl’s practical worth. Acoustic behavior, frequency accuracy, and tonal stability determine how effectively the bowl performs across meditation, therapy, and instructional settings.
- Sustained vibration quality: Well-crafted bowls generate layered overtones that flow smoothly and evenly. Stable vibration indicates a balanced metal structure and precise shaping. Irregular resonance often signals internal inconsistencies affecting sound depth.
- Frequency alignment: Professionally made bowls produce reliable and repeatable frequency ranges. This consistency supports focused meditation and therapeutic applications. Accurate tones enhance usability in instructional and guided practices.
- Sound projection and clarity: Balanced construction allows sound to spread evenly across the space. Clear projection prevents sudden loss of tone or uneven volume. This makes the bowl effective for both individual and group environments.
When acoustic precision is prioritized, sound quality becomes a dependable attribute rather than an unpredictable outcome.
Functional Application and Intended Use
Not all singing bowls serve the same purpose. Design decisions tailored to specific applications influence usability, interaction consistency, and long-term performance in professional and personal environments.
- Purpose-driven design: Different applications require specific dimensions, weight balance, and tonal depth. Design choices are aligned with meditation, therapy, or instructional needs. This functional focus directly affects manufacturing precision and overall value.
- User interaction consistency: Quality bowls respond evenly to changes in mallet pressure and movement. Predictable feedback improves control and sound accuracy during practice. This consistency supports both beginners and experienced practitioners.
- Professional reliability: Dependable performance reduces wear-related issues in regular use. Consistent sound quality enhances trust in professional and retail settings. Long-term reliability strengthens overall investment value.
Aligning design with intended use ensures that the bowl functions as a practical instrument, not merely an ornamental object.
